use std::ffi::{c_char, c_void, CStr};
use std::ptr;
use binaryninjacore_sys::*;
use crate::binary_view::BinaryView;
use crate::flowgraph::FlowGraph;
use crate::interaction::form::{Form, FormInputField};
use crate::interaction::report::{Report, ReportCollection};
use crate::interaction::{MessageBoxButtonResult, MessageBoxButtonSet, MessageBoxIcon};
use crate::string::{raw_to_string, BnString};
pub fn register_interaction_handler<R: InteractionHandler>(custom: R) {
let leak_custom = Box::leak(Box::new(custom));
let mut callbacks = BNInteractionHandlerCallbacks {
context: leak_custom as *mut R as *mut c_void,
showPlainTextReport: Some(cb_show_plain_text_report::<R>),
showMarkdownReport: Some(cb_show_markdown_report::<R>),
showHTMLReport: Some(cb_show_html_report::<R>),
showGraphReport: Some(cb_show_graph_report::<R>),
showReportCollection: Some(cb_show_report_collection::<R>),
getTextLineInput: Some(cb_get_text_line_input::<R>),
getIntegerInput: Some(cb_get_integer_input::<R>),
getAddressInput: Some(cb_get_address_input::<R>),
getChoiceInput: Some(cb_get_choice_input::<R>),
getLargeChoiceInput: Some(cb_get_large_choice_input::<R>),
getOpenFileNameInput: Some(cb_get_open_file_name_input::<R>),
getSaveFileNameInput: Some(cb_get_save_file_name_input::<R>),
getDirectoryNameInput: Some(cb_get_directory_name_input::<R>),
getFormInput: Some(cb_get_form_input::<R>),
showMessageBox: Some(cb_show_message_box::<R>),
openUrl: Some(cb_open_url::<R>),
runProgressDialog: Some(cb_run_progress_dialog::<R>),
};
unsafe { BNRegisterInteractionHandler(&mut callbacks) }
}
pub trait InteractionHandler: Sync + Send + 'static {
fn show_message_box(
&mut self,
title: &str,
text: &str,
buttons: MessageBoxButtonSet,
icon: MessageBoxIcon,
) -> MessageBoxButtonResult;
fn open_url(&mut self, url: &str) -> bool;
fn run_progress_dialog(
&mut self,
title: &str,
can_cancel: bool,
task: &InteractionHandlerTask,
) -> bool;
fn show_plain_text_report(&mut self, view: Option<&BinaryView>, title: &str, contents: &str);
fn show_graph_report(&mut self, view: Option<&BinaryView>, title: &str, graph: &FlowGraph);
fn show_markdown_report(
&mut self,
view: Option<&BinaryView>,
title: &str,
_contents: &str,
plain_text: &str,
) {
self.show_plain_text_report(view, title, plain_text);
}
fn show_html_report(
&mut self,
view: Option<&BinaryView>,
title: &str,
_contents: &str,
plain_text: &str,
) {
self.show_plain_text_report(view, title, plain_text);
}
fn show_report_collection(&mut self, _title: &str, reports: &ReportCollection) {
for report in reports {
match &report {
Report::PlainText(rpt) => self.show_plain_text_report(
report.view().as_deref(),
&report.title(),
&rpt.contents(),
),
Report::Markdown(rm) => self.show_markdown_report(
report.view().as_deref(),
&report.title(),
&rm.contents(),
&rm.plaintext(),
),
Report::Html(rh) => self.show_html_report(
report.view().as_deref(),
&report.title(),
&rh.contents(),
&rh.plaintext(),
),
Report::FlowGraph(rfg) => self.show_graph_report(
report.view().as_deref(),
&report.title(),
&rfg.flow_graph(),
),
}
}
}
fn get_form_input(&mut self, form: &mut Form) -> bool;
fn get_text_line_input(&mut self, prompt: &str, title: &str) -> Option<String> {
let mut form = Form::new(title.to_owned());
form.add_field(FormInputField::TextLine {
prompt: prompt.to_string(),
default: None,
value: None,
});
if !self.get_form_input(&mut form) {
return None;
}
form.get_field_with_name(prompt)
.and_then(|f| f.try_value_string())
}
fn get_integer_input(&mut self, prompt: &str, title: &str) -> Option<i64> {
let mut form = Form::new(title.to_owned());
form.add_field(FormInputField::Integer {
prompt: prompt.to_string(),
value: 0,
default: None,
});
if !self.get_form_input(&mut form) {
return None;
}
form.get_field_with_name(prompt)
.and_then(|f| f.try_value_int())
}
fn get_address_input(
&mut self,
prompt: &str,
title: &str,
view: Option<&BinaryView>,
current_addr: u64,
) -> Option<u64> {
let mut form = Form::new(title.to_owned());
form.add_field(FormInputField::Address {
prompt: prompt.to_string(),
view: view.map(|v| v.to_owned()),
current_address: current_addr,
value: 0,
default: None,
});
if !self.get_form_input(&mut form) {
return None;
}
form.get_field_with_name(prompt)
.and_then(|f| f.try_value_address())
}
fn get_choice_input(
&mut self,
prompt: &str,
title: &str,
choices: Vec<String>,
) -> Option<usize> {
let mut form = Form::new(title.to_owned());
form.add_field(FormInputField::Choice {
prompt: prompt.to_string(),
choices,
default: None,
value: 0,
});
if !self.get_form_input(&mut form) {
return None;
}
form.get_field_with_name(prompt)
.and_then(|f| f.try_value_index())
}
fn get_large_choice_input(
&mut self,
prompt: &str,
title: &str,
choices: Vec<String>,
) -> Option<usize> {
self.get_choice_input(prompt, title, choices)
}
fn get_open_file_name_input(
&mut self,
prompt: &str,
extension: Option<String>,
) -> Option<String> {
let mut form = Form::new(prompt.to_owned());
form.add_field(FormInputField::OpenFileName {
prompt: prompt.to_string(),
default: None,
value: None,
extension,
});
if !self.get_form_input(&mut form) {
return None;
}
form.get_field_with_name(prompt)
.and_then(|f| f.try_value_string())
}
fn get_save_file_name_input(
&mut self,
prompt: &str,
extension: Option<String>,
default_name: Option<String>,
) -> Option<String> {
let mut form = Form::new(prompt.to_owned());
form.add_field(FormInputField::SaveFileName {
prompt: prompt.to_string(),
extension,
default: None,
value: None,
default_name,
});
if !self.get_form_input(&mut form) {
return None;
}
form.get_field_with_name(prompt)
.and_then(|f| f.try_value_string())
}
fn get_directory_name_input(
&mut self,
prompt: &str,
default_name: Option<String>,
) -> Option<String> {
let mut form = Form::new(prompt.to_owned());
form.add_field(FormInputField::DirectoryName {
prompt: prompt.to_string(),
default_name,
default: None,
value: None,
});
if !self.get_form_input(&mut form) {
return None;
}
form.get_field_with_name(prompt)
.and_then(|f| f.try_value_string())
}
}
pub struct InteractionHandlerTask {
ctxt: *mut c_void,
task: Option<
unsafe extern "C" fn(
taskCtxt: *mut c_void,
progress: Option<
unsafe extern "C" fn(progressCtxt: *mut c_void, cur: usize, max: usize) -> bool,
>,
progressCtxt: *mut c_void,
),
>,
}
impl InteractionHandlerTask {
pub fn task<P: FnMut(usize, usize) -> bool>(&mut self, progress: &mut P) {
let Some(task) = self.task else {
return;
};
let progress_ctxt = progress as *mut P as *mut c_void;
ffi_wrap!("custom_interaction_run_progress_dialog", unsafe {
task(
self.ctxt,
Some(cb_custom_interaction_handler_task::<P>),
progress_ctxt,
)
})
}
}
